BASETRAP/4/CPUUSAGERESUME: OID [oid] CPU utilization recovered to the normal range. (Index=[INTEGER], BaseUsagePhyIndex=[INTEGER], UsageType=[INTEGER], UsageIndex=[INTEGER], Severity=[INTEGER], ProbableCause=[INTEGER], EventType=[INTEGER], PhysicalName="[OCTET]", RelativeResource="[OCTET]", UsageValue=[INTEGER], UsageUnit=[INTEGER], UsageThreshold=[INTEGER])
This recovery notification is generated when the CPU usage is reduced to the normal range.

Name | Meaning |
---|---|
oid |
Indicates the MIB object ID of the alarm. |
Index |
Indicates the index of the entity. |
BaseUsagePhyIndex |
Indicates the index of the physical entity. |
UsageType |
Indicates the type of the alarm on usage. |
UsageIndex |
Indicates the index of the sub-entity of the alarm entity. In the alarm on CPU usage, the fixed value of this parameter is 0. |
ProbableCause |
Indicates the possible causes of the alarm. The codes of the possible causes are as follows: 1024: IANAITUPROBABLECAUSE_OTHER indicates that the causes are unknown. |
EventType |
Indicates the alarm type. Alarms are classified into the following types:
This alarm is an alarm of the environmentalAlarm type. |
PhysicalName |
Indicates the name of the entity. |
RelativeResource |
Indicates the resources that are associated with the alarm. The current value on the device is null. |
UsageValue |
Indicates the CPU usage of the current board. |
UsageUnit |
Indicates the unit of the CPU usage. The unit is percent. |
UsageThreshold |
Indicates the alarm threshold of CPU usage. |
